💬What is Monsters Car?

You click. The car lurches forward. A one-eyed green thing with tusks grins from the driver's seat. That's the whole loop, and somehow it's stupidly fun. Monsters Car is one of those games where the premise makes no sense but the moment-to-moment clicking feels weirdly satisfying. You're not steering much — just hammer the mouse or spacebar to keep your monster mobile from stalling out, dodge the occasional wreck, and see how far you can get before the road eats you. The first time I missed a click and watched my monster plow into a pile of tires, I actually laughed out loud. The physics are bouncy and forgiving enough that you don't rage, but there's still that tiny tension of "will the next click be enough?" Upgrades pop up as you collect shiny junk, and you'll start eyeing that bigger engine or spikier bumper. It's not deep, but it's exactly the kind of thing you open for two minutes and then realize forty minutes vanished. One thing I noticed: different monsters actually feel different. The little purple guy accelerates fast but tops out quick. The big horned brute takes forever to get going but smashes through barriers without slowing. That tiny bit of variety kept me clicking just to see what the next unlock would do. Don't expect a story or complex controls — it's raw, dumb, click-to-go fun with a monster behind the wheel.

Game Tips

Click rhythm matters more than raw speed — steady beats beat frantic flailing. Upgrade your engine first; more acceleration per click changes everything. Let off the clicking on downhill stretches to save your finger and avoid overheating. Try each monster before spending coins on cosmetics; their handling differs a lot. Keep an eye on the road edge — clipping a barrier costs more time than it saves. If your hand cramps, switch to spacebar; same control, less wrist strain.
